The UA System is Alabama's largest higher education enterprise, comprising three research universities - The University of Alabama, The University of Alabama at Birmingham, and The University of Alabama in Huntsville - along with the UAB Health System and numerous affiliated entities. Collectively, the UA System provides educational services to more than 71,500 students while supporting a workforce of over 67,000.
Founded in 1831 as the state's flagship university, UA is an R1 research institution serving over 40,000 students across 200 plus degree programs. UA holds a strong reputation of academic and athletic excellence while maintaining a commitment to advancing the intellectual and social condition of people through education, research, and service. UA's vibrant campus sits along the banks of the Black Warrior River in Tuscaloosa, which is regularly ranked among the nation's best college towns.
